LOL glad you had a good time, we didn't get quite as far down as Bala as the weather was a bit murkier in North Wales!
We did manage a 240-mile trip though, starting off heading off towards Ruthin then taking some of the real windy single-track roads through a forest whose name escapes me. Couple of hairy moments there, as some of the roads were very steep, and there was quite a lot of mud & gravel about, but managed to stay upright despite a couple of fairly impressive back-end slides - bet I couldn't have done those if I'd been trying to! Himself managed to actually come off the road and get a bit stuck in the verge at one point ( that'll teach you to take me on "difficult" roads on our first major ride of the year!) but some judicious shoving soon had us on our way again.
Managed a stop at the Ponderosa at Llangollen once I actually found the road it was on - conversation had gone:
- You go in front says he.
- I don't know the way says I
- Straight up the road says he
- OK says I
....until I noticed he wasn't behind me any more, and had failed to mention the right-hand turn we needed to do so that was me u-turning and haring back to try and find him!
Once we were on the way back and I knew the way I let him go off and play on the twisties whilst I followed behind at a slightly more sedate pace.
Only one BMW tried to overtake on a bend and kill me this time out, was quite funny watching the other half (who was a fair way in front but had seen how close he came in his mirrors) go tearing after him yelling "DICKHEAD" at the top of his voice.
Nice to see so many other bikes out & about enjoying the weather, and boy isn't the M56 a boring motorway!
